The second meaning is internal: the design team, GC, or an independent reviewer reads the drawing set to catch coordination errors, specification mismatches, and cross-discipline conflicts before construction starts.<\/p>\n<p>Both are important. But they&#8217;re not the same activity, they catch different problems, and they happen on different timelines. Understanding where each one falls short is how you understand why construction projects still run over budget even when they pass code review.<\/p>\n<h2 id=\"the-two-kinds-of-plan-review\">The two kinds of plan review<\/h2>\n<h3 id=\"ahj--permit-plan-review\">AHJ \/ permit plan review<\/h3>\n<p>When you submit construction documents to a building department, a plans examiner reviews them for compliance with the adopted building code \u2014 the IBC, local zoning ordinances, fire and life-safety requirements, accessibility standards, and similar regulatory frameworks. The examiner&#8217;s job is to confirm that what you&#8217;re proposing to build meets the minimum standards the jurisdiction requires.<\/p>\n<p>This review is mandatory for permitted work, and it can be extensive. Common rejection reasons include:<\/p>\n<ul>\n<li>Incomplete or missing code calculations (structural, egress, energy compliance)<\/li>\n<li>Insufficient fire-protection or life-safety documentation<\/li>\n<li>ADA compliance gaps<\/li>\n<li>Inconsistent or missing details that the examiner needs to verify code conformance<\/li>\n<li>Scope of work described too vaguely to permit<\/li>\n<\/ul>\n<p>Permit review timelines vary enormously by jurisdiction, project type, and current backlog \u2014 ranging from a few days for over-the-counter residential permits to several months for complex commercial projects in busy departments.<\/p>\n<p>What AHJ review does <strong>not<\/strong> do: it does not read every sheet against every other sheet. It does not verify that the structural drawings and the mechanical drawings are coordinated. It does not catch a dimension that conflicts between the architectural floor plan and the structural layout. Those are internal coordination problems, and no building department is staffed to find them. They&#8217;re your problem.<\/p>\n<h3 id=\"internal-qa--coordination-review\">Internal QA \/ coordination review<\/h3>\n<p>The second type of plan review is the one the project team runs \u2014 or should run \u2014 before the documents are issued for bid or construction. This is where cross-discipline conflicts, specification mismatches, and coordination gaps are supposed to get caught.<\/p>\n<p>In practice, it looks something like a senior project architect or PM walking through the drawing set looking for problems. On well-resourced projects it&#8217;s formalized as a design review gate; on most projects it&#8217;s squeezed into whatever time exists before the issue deadline. Either way, the core task is the same: read the full document set \u2014 every discipline, every sheet, plus the project manual \u2014 and identify places where things don&#8217;t agree.<\/p>\n<p>This is the review that a <a href=\"\/construction-document-review-checklist\/\">construction document review checklist<\/a> is designed to structure. And it&#8217;s the review where the most expensive conflicts get caught or missed.<\/p>\n<h2 id=\"where-conflicts-actually-hide\">Where conflicts actually hide<\/h2>\n<p>The conflicts that drive change orders and rework are distributed problems. They don&#8217;t live on one sheet \u2014 they live <em>between<\/em> sheets, between disciplines, between the drawings and the specifications. That&#8217;s what makes them hard to catch manually.<\/p>\n<h3 id=\"spec-vs-drawing-conflicts\">Spec-vs-drawing conflicts<\/h3>\n<p>The specification section calls one product or assembly. The drawing detail shows another. Neither is &#8220;wrong&#8221; on its own \u2014 they just disagree. When the field hits it, someone has to issue a clarification, price the difference, and often demo work that&#8217;s already in place.<\/p>\n<h3 id=\"cross-sheet-conflicts\">Cross-sheet conflicts<\/h3>\n<p>A dimension or elevation on one sheet doesn&#8217;t match the same element on another. Architectural and structural floor plans carry different slab thicknesses. A section cut references a detail that was never updated after a design revision. These conflicts are obvious in retrospect and genuinely hard to catch when you&#8217;re reading one sheet at a time under deadline pressure.<\/p>\n<h3 id=\"cross-discipline-conflicts\">Cross-discipline conflicts<\/h3>\n<p>The canonical case: structure, MEP, and architecture each solve their own scope correctly, and the seams between them don&#8217;t line up. A structural shear wall is placed exactly where the mechanical drawings route a main supply duct. Neither drawing is internally inconsistent. A renovation adds a structure, but the fire-alarm device layout isn&#8217;t extended onto it. An ADA clearance is required but no sheet accounts for it. A detail is referenced in the drawings but never actually drawn. These are the hardest type to catch because there&#8217;s no internal inconsistency to notice \u2014 you only find them by knowing what should be there.<\/p>\n<h2 id=\"the-catch-rate-problem\">The catch rate problem<\/h2>\n<p>Manual review catches some of these conflicts. It doesn&#8217;t catch all of them \u2014 not because reviewers aren&#8217;t competent, but because the task is genuinely hard at scale. A large drawing set means hundreds of sheets across architectural, structural, mechanical, electrical, plumbing, fire protection, fire alarm, low-voltage, telecom, civil, landscape, interior design, food service, and signage disciplines, plus a project manual with dozens of specification sections. Reading every sheet against every other sheet, without fatigue, without missing a cross-reference, is not something humans do reliably under deadline conditions.<\/p>\n<p>Errors caught during construction cost <strong>far more<\/strong> to fix than the same errors caught during plan review. The industry&#8217;s cost-of-change curve (Construction Users Roundtable, 2004) is the standard statement of it, and it is a principle rather than a measured multiplier. The math is straightforward: a conflict caught on a PDF costs a markup and a design coordination meeting. The same conflict caught in the field costs demolition, rework, a change order, and schedule impact. The benchmark Flikt uses across projects is <strong>conflicts per 100 sheets<\/strong> \u2014 a normalized drawing-quality metric that lets owners and GCs compare document quality across design teams and project phases rather than relying on gut feel.<\/p>\n<h2 id=\"who-runs-which-review--and-when\">Who runs which review \u2014 and when<\/h2>\n<p>Here&#8217;s how the two types of plan review fit into a typical project timeline:<\/p>\n<p><strong>Design development through CD completion<\/strong> \u2014 Internal QA review runs iteratively as discipline sets are issued. Cross-discipline conflicts and spec mismatches are most efficiently caught here, when revisions are still cheap and the design team is still assembled.<\/p>\n<p><strong>Before bid \/ CD issue<\/strong> \u2014 Final internal review pass. This is where <a href=\"\/construction-document-review-checklist\/\">a construction document review checklist<\/a> is most directly useful \u2014 a structured sweep that confirms the documents are ready to go out without the coordination gaps that generate pre-bid RFIs.<\/p>\n<p><strong>Permit submission and AHJ review<\/strong> \u2014 Runs in parallel or immediately after CD completion. AHJ review is largely independent of internal QA; passing permit review does not mean the documents are free of coordination conflicts.<\/p>\n<p><strong>Pre-construction \/ GMP negotiation<\/strong> \u2014 GCs running their own document review before committing a Guaranteed Maximum Price have a particular interest in finding conflicts that will show up as change orders. <a href=\"\/for-general-contractors\/\">Flikt for general contractors<\/a> is aimed directly at this moment.<\/p>\n<p>The separation is worth stating plainly: a stamped, permitted set of documents is not the same as a coordinated set of documents. Permit review is a code-compliance check. Coordination review is a buildability check.
